Mind-Body Relationship Dynamics
While frequently disregarded, the dynamics of the mind-body interrelation play a vital role in overall wellness. This connection demonstrates how mental states can influence physical health and vice versa. For instance, positive thoughts and emotions can strengthen immune function, while negative feelings may result in physical ailments. In addition, practices such as mindfulness and meditation have proven the ability to foster a harmonious connection between mental and physical states, encouraging relaxation and reducing tension. Understanding this interplay urges individuals to adopt holistic practices that address both mental and physical health. By recognizing the profound influence of thoughts and emotions on bodily health, individuals can nurture a balanced approach to wellness that nurtures both the mind and body, ultimately resulting in a more fulfilling life.

Stress Management Techniques
How can individuals effectively manage stress in their daily lives? Employing multiple stress management techniques can substantially boost emotional health. Activities such as mindfulness meditation promote self-awareness and help individuals disconnect from stressors. Physical activities, including yoga and regular exercise, release endorphins, which are natural mood enhancers. In addition, maintaining a balanced diet enhances overall mental health, providing the necessary nutrients to combat stress. Time management strategies, such as prioritizing tasks and setting realistic goals, can reduce feelings of being overwhelmed. Social support networks, whether through friends, family, or support groups, provide emotional relief and shared experiences. By integrating these methods into daily routines, individuals can develop resilience, resulting in improved emotional stability and enhanced quality of life.

Crafting a Custom Wellbeing Plan
A personalized wellness plan enables individuals to tailor their health and wellness practices to meet their unique needs and goals. This program includes diverse elements, comprising physical, mental, emotional, and spiritual wellness. Persons commence by examining their existing health state, determining strengths, vulnerabilities, and sectors for development. They might define precise, trackable targets such as increasing fitness capacity, handling stress, or refining dietary intake. Combining different activities—such as fitness programs, mindfulness approaches, and eating adjustments—further individualizes the method. Consistent assessments of advancement enable modifications, guaranteeing the strategy stays synchronized with changing objectives. Finally, an individualized wellness program encourages a forward-thinking perspective, allowing persons to seize command of their health and nurture a well-rounded, satisfying lifestyle.

Do Holistic Practices Carry Any Risks or Adverse Effects?
Indeed, holistic approaches may cause harm or produce adverse effects. Individuals may experience negative reactions to certain herbs or therapies, and dismissing conventional medicine can intensify medical concerns, emphasizing the necessity of making well-informed choices.
